Install the base unit awayfromelectronic equipment such a s p e r s o n a l computers, television sets or microwave ovens. Avoid excessive heat, cold, dust or moisture.

Connect the power and telephone line cords to the underside of the base as illustrated.

Connect the power cord. After charging the battery for at least 16 hours, connect the telephone line cord.
